Great & friendly service. The restaurant is plenty big & clean. The kids really liked the 2025 scroll we got at the end. The portions were too big to finish! 2 adults & 2 kids, we ordered 2 entrees & a 2 item PuPu platter with egg drop soup. We took enough food home that we will have dinner from all the leftovers later this week. The only reason we did not do a 5 star rating is the egg drop soup was not our favorite. It wasn't bad, just not the best we have had. Everything else was terrific. We recommend this restaurant for great value, excellent staff, clean environment & delicious food.
